May 25-28 2007. Memorial Day weekend.
Located in and around Rio Rancho/Albuquerque, NM. Registration is FREE! Every attendee gets a FREE T-shirt or Hat. (We'll decide later) Beer is FREE! Most meals are FREE! Nico, Liz, Luckie and myself are looking to put on the social event of 2007. We are paying for the shirts, beer and food so you don't have to. My intention is to attempt to have the first mixing of Texans/Okies with the Westerners. I want to coax guys across the invisible barrier that seems to exist at the TX/NM state line. Basic itinerary: Friday: Reception and Beer drinking. Saturday: Drive to Sandia Crest (about 45min to 10,300'). Group photos. Drive home for cookout and beer. Sunday: Car wash. Car show. Cookout and beer. Awards. Monday: Group breakfast. Afternoon beers. This event is intended to have less driving and more socializing. After all, you drove enough just to get here. We have a dedicated brewery and a fun-loving staff. There will be no politics on this one. We are taking full financial responsibility, so we answer only to ourselves. This is a general discussion thread. The official registration thread will follow some time next month. Potential sponsors: Please PM me with offers. Who's coming? 60 People! and 36 914s!
